新工科背景下仪器分析及实验教学改革与实践

仪器分析及实验是化学工程与工艺专业的重要课程.传统教学模式注重复杂理论,缺乏应用技能和创新思维培养,难以满足"新工科"人才培养需求.为解决此问题,教学团队秉持"以学生为中心,以问题为导向"的理念,推进"双元三阶四法"教学创新模式,整合内容、丰富模式、强化思政、完善评价,融入现代信息技术,实现课堂新转变,有效提高学生综合能力及素质,为"新工科"课程教学改革提供借鉴.
